Let's say you submit a song to Taxi. THEN you make a few final tweaks. Nothing major... revise a track's EQ, adjust the mastering, etc. THEN you hear from the library or music supervisor that Taxi forwarded it to.

At that point would you send them your newly tweaked track, or send them the older one that Taxi forwarded them, as that's what they received and liked in the first place?

Well, hopefully, the tweeks are an improvement in one manner or another. Right? Why else would you have made any changes.

Personally, I'd send the new version. It's been my experience that they ask for alt versions anyway. As long as the underlying song is like 99% the same, let it roll. Now if you have rewritten a verse, changed lyrics, changed keys, changed tempo or something like that, just ask... maybe send them both and see which version they like better.
